IDCRP-154: Comparative Immunogenicity of Respiratory Virus Vaccines (CIRV2) Study
Henry M. Jackson Foundation for the Advancement of Military Medicine·interventional·Posted Dec 17, 2025·Updated May 4, 2026
In Brief
A Phase 4 clinical trial evaluating Pfizer-BioNTech mRNA COVID-19 vaccine and Novavax recombinant protein vaccine for COVID -19 and 7 related conditions. Active but no longer recruiting, targeting 54 participants across 1 site.
Detailed Summary
CIRV2 is a Phase IV randomized, open-label, trial of FDA-approved COVID-19 and/or influenza vaccines (no more than minimal risk) with longitudinal follow-up. In 2025 CIRV2 will compare immunogenicity and reactogenicity of the recombinant Novavax COVID-19 vaccine and the mRNA Pfizer-BioNTech COVID-19 vaccine.
